Bio
I've been involved in Chapman genealogy for some 40 years. My initiation into anything that resembles organized genealogy was due to Gil Alford who started a newsletter ("Chapman Chatter") which eventually led to the Chapman Family Association (www.chapmanfamilies.org). I continue to be involved with this organization. We encourage any with Chapman ancestry to make contact.
Most of my efforts are devoted to the SW MO & a bit of N.W. AR, N.E. OK & S.E. KS cemeteries. I encourage contact, corrections & comments & am pleased to transfer to family members. If you have a better photo, go ahead & post but let me know so I can delete mine.
